市场概述

全球谷物市场规模在2022年达到403亿美元,预计到2030年将达到530亿美元。在2023-2030年的预测期内,该市场的复合年增长率为3.5%。

谷物是一种流行的早餐食品,由谷物制成,通常与牛奶或酸奶一起食用。谷物加工包括将未加工的全谷物转化为可食用谷物的一系列步骤。谷物的形状多种多样,包括薄片、泡芙、燕麦片和其他纹理形状。谷物通常由小麦、玉米、燕麦或大米等未加工的全谷物制成。

强化谷物食品富含维生素和矿物质,以提高其营养价值。为了提高口感,它们还可能添加糖、干果、坚果或其他调味品。消费者对健康食品的需求已成为谷物市场的一个重要趋势。植物性饮食的日益流行也对谷物市场产生了影响。

市场动态

对健康营养食品需求的增长推动了谷物市场的增长

消费者日益意识到健康饮食的重要性及其对整体健康的影响,这推动了对包括谷物在内的营养食品的需求。谷物,尤其是全谷物谷物,是人体必需营养素、膳食纤维、维生素和矿物质的丰富来源。

例如,强化谷物食品每1杯(40克)含铁40毫克,是每日摄入量的100%。谷物提供的蛋白质占每日需要量的50%以上,其中蛋白质含量为6-12%,通常缺乏赖氨酸。因此,人们对健康营养食品的需求不断增长,推动了谷物行业的市场增长。

人们对谷物中糖分和添加剂的健康关注度升高可能阻碍谷物市场的增长。

一些谷物中添加了大量的糖和人工添加剂,导致人们担心它们对整体健康的影响,包括体重管理、糖尿病和其他相关健康问题。因此,一些消费者正在减少谷物的消费或转而食用更健康的替代品。营养学家建议消费者避免食用每份含糖量超过10克的谷物。但是,每100克谷物(一份)的平均含糖量通常为19.8克。因此,人们对谷物中的糖和添加剂的健康问题日益关注,这可能会制约谷物行业的市场增长。

Market Overview

The Global Cereals Market reached US$ 40.3 billion in 2022 and is projected to witness lucrative growth by reaching up to US$ 53 billion by 2030. The market is growing at a CAGR of 3.5% during the forecast period 2023-2030.

Cereals are a popular breakfast food made from cereal grains and often consumed with milk or yogurt. Cereal processing includes a series of steps involved in transforming raw whole grains into edible cereals. Cereals come in various forms, including flakes, puffs, granola, and other textured shapes. Cereals are typically made from raw whole grains such as wheat, corn, oats, or rice.

Fortified cereals are rich in vitamins and minerals to enhance their nutritional value. To enhance taste, they may also contain added sugar, dried fruits, nuts, or other flavorings. Consumer demand for healthier food options has been a significant trend in the cereal market. The rising popularity of plant-based diets has also influenced the cereal market.

Market Dynamics

Growing Demand for Healthy and Nutritious Food is Driving the Market Growth of the Cereal Market

Increasing consumer awareness of the importance of a healthy diet and its impact on overall well-being drives the demand for nutritious food options, including cereals. Cereals, particularly those made from whole grains, are a rich source of essential nutrients, dietary fiber, vitamins, and minerals.

For instance, Fortified cereal contains 40 mg of iron in 1 cup (40 grams), which is 100% of the Daily Value. Grains supply more than 50% of the daily requirement for protein and include 6-12% protein, typically lysine-deficient. Hence, the growing demand for healthy and nutritious food is driving the market growth of the cereal industry.

Rising Health Concerns About Sugar and Additives Present in Cereals can Hamper the Growth of the Cereal Market.

High levels of added sugars and artificial additives in some cereals have led to concerns about their impact on overall health, including weight management, diabetes, and other related health conditions. As a result, some consumers are reducing their consumption of cereals or switching to healthier alternatives. Nutritionists advise consumers to avoid grains that contain more than 10 grams of sugar per serving. But for every 100 grams of cereal (one serving), the average cereal box typically includes 19.8 grams of sugar. Hence, rising health concerns about sugar and additives in cereals can restrain the cereal industry's market growth.

Segment Analysis

The Global Cereal Market is segmented based on product type, ingredient, and region.

Convenience, Variety, and Taste of Ready-to-Eat Cereals

Based on product type, the cereal market is divided into hot cereal, ready-to-eat cereal, and others.

In 2022, Ready-to-eat cereals gained a significant market share in the cereal industry due it's convenience, variety, and taste. Ready-to-eat grains are designed to be consumed without additional cooking or preparation. They are pre-packaged and can be eaten directly from the box or with milk or yogurt.

This convenience has made them extremely popular among consumers seeking quick and easy breakfast options. Ready-to-eat cereals come in various flavors, textures, and types to cater to consumer preferences. Manufacturers offer an extensive selection, including traditional flakes, granola, puffed grains, clusters, and more.

Geographical Analysis

Growing Consumption of Cereals by Large-size Population in the Asia-Pacific Region

The Asia Pacific region has a large population, including highly populous countries like China and India. The area's high population density and dietary preferences contribute to substantial cereal consumption. For instance, according to Statista, About 232 million metric tonnes of cereal were available in India in the fiscal year 2022. Cereals, such as rice and wheat, are staple foods in many Asian countries, forming the basis of their diets. Favorable climatic conditions, fertile lands, and advanced agricultural practices have enabled the cultivation of cereals on a large scale. The region's agricultural productivity plays a crucial role in meeting domestic demands and supporting export markets.
